If you are refering to mpeg4 formats, this is really a compression codec that allows one to fit a full length DVD to a single cdr that is playable in a dvd-rom (i.e. PC) only. Its really known as a back up procedure for dvd and I don't believe any commercial standalone DVD players can recognize it.Tygrus
